Creating the Erie Canal
February 24 at 6:30 P.M.

This documentary, produced by Tom Garber to celebrate the bicentennial of the opening of the canal (1825), tells the captivating story of upstate New York pioneers who actually designed and built the world’s longest hand dug canal. It also relates the story of the loss of Haudenosaunee native American culture under the influence of manifest destiny. Tom will be available for questions following showing.
